The purpose of this study is to determine the effects of Low Frequency Repetitive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ation (LF r-TMS) of the pre-Supplementary Motor Area (pre-SMA) on tremor as measured by the tremor rating scale (TRS) in patients with Essential Tremor (ET).
Hypothesis: Pre-SMA LF r-TMS will result in a >30% reduction in tremor as measured by the TRS. Another purpose of this study is to identify the mechanism by which LF r-TMS of the pre-SMA effects tremor in patients with ET.
Hypothesis: Inhibition of the pre-SMA by LF r-TMS improves tremor in ET by normalizing pre-SMA output, and improving motor control, as determined shortening of the delay in the second agonist burst, seen in ET patients. At conclusion of this study expect to have sufficient pilot data to justify larger pivotal trials designed to establish the efficacy of pre-SMA r-TMS in ET.

| Active pre-SMA rTMS | Experimental | The intervention to be administered is the MagVenture MagProx100 Stimulator with a Cool-B65 A/P coil l to administer active rTMS at 1Hz, 1,200sec, 110% resting motor threshold (rMT); 1200 pulses total. Two Thymapad Stimulus Electrodes will be placed in the appropriate position during active rTMS administration.This intervention method will be used for all 15 treatment sessions (20 minutes/session). |
|
| Sham pre-SMA rTMS | Sham Comparator | The intervention to be administered is the eSHAM system used in conjunction with the MagVenture MagProx100 Stimulator with the Cool-B65 A/P Coil. For eSHAM administration two Thymapad Stimulus Electrodes will be placed on the scalp location that corresponded to left DLPFC. This intervention method will be used for all 15 treatment sessions (20 minutes/session). Previous studies have shown the eSHAM system effectively blinds participants to rTMS treatment (active versus sham). |
